Abstract :
An antenna for service in the 30-50 Mc band is presented which affords a high degree of immunity from the noise of precipitation static and corona. Throughout this paper the noise caused by the impingement of charged particles is termed precipitation static. Corona is treated separately. A predominant feature of this design is a dielectric sheath enclosing the radiating conductor. A study of the causes of precipitation noise show it to arise principally from a spark between a charged particle of precipitation and the antenna conductor. Noise from this source is estimated to be reduced about 30 db by the dielectric sheath. Experimental apparatus is described which enables quantitative measurements to be conducted in the laboratory. A standard approach is used to minimize corona effects.
